Nitika Chopra, the founder and CEO of Chronicon and the Chronicon foundation, is a dedicated advocate for empowering individuals with chronic illness. Having faced her own journey marked by psoriasis and psoriatic arthritis since childhood, Nitika's entrepreneurial spirit led her to host her own TV show, Naturally Beautiful, and organize over a hundred transformative events. Her influence extends to major partnerships with brands like Google, Microsoft, and Bristol Myers Squibb, where she passionately advocates for the chronic illness community.
